We include different mechanisms of $\\gamma\\gamma\\to\\gamma\\gamma$ scattering, such as double-hadronic photon fluctuations, $t/u$-channel neutral pion exchange or resonance excitations ($\\gamma \\gamma \\to R$) and deexcitation ($R \\to \\gamma \\gamma$). The broad range of (pseudo)rapidities and lower cuts on transverse momenta open a necessity to consider not only dominant box contributions but also other subleading contributions.
